Mercurial > geeqie
comparison src/editors.c @ 1765:650915809048
use text renderer for editor->hidden
The toggle was too confusing because it was not dirrectly editable.
author | nadvornik |
---|---|
date | Sat, 10 Oct 2009 10:15:23 +0000 |
parents | ebfb5af3f5de |
children | 956aab097ea7 |
comparison
equal
deleted
inserted
replaced
1764:91ec4714b905 | 1765:650915809048 |
---|---|
329 | 329 |
330 gtk_list_store_append(desktop_file_list, &iter); | 330 gtk_list_store_append(desktop_file_list, &iter); |
331 gtk_list_store_set(desktop_file_list, &iter, | 331 gtk_list_store_set(desktop_file_list, &iter, |
332 DESKTOP_FILE_COLUMN_KEY, key, | 332 DESKTOP_FILE_COLUMN_KEY, key, |
333 DESKTOP_FILE_COLUMN_NAME, editor->name, | 333 DESKTOP_FILE_COLUMN_NAME, editor->name, |
334 DESKTOP_FILE_COLUMN_HIDDEN, editor->hidden, | 334 DESKTOP_FILE_COLUMN_HIDDEN, editor->hidden ? _("yes") : _("no"), |
335 DESKTOP_FILE_COLUMN_WRITABLE, access_file(path, W_OK), | 335 DESKTOP_FILE_COLUMN_WRITABLE, access_file(path, W_OK), |
336 DESKTOP_FILE_COLUMN_PATH, path, -1); | 336 DESKTOP_FILE_COLUMN_PATH, path, -1); |
337 | 337 |
338 return TRUE; | 338 return TRUE; |
339 } | 339 } |
356 { | 356 { |
357 gtk_list_store_clear(desktop_file_list); | 357 gtk_list_store_clear(desktop_file_list); |
358 } | 358 } |
359 else | 359 else |
360 { | 360 { |
361 desktop_file_list = gtk_list_store_new(DESKTOP_FILE_COLUMN_COUNT, G_TYPE_STRING, G_TYPE_STRING, G_TYPE_BOOLEAN, G_TYPE_BOOLEAN, G_TYPE_STRING); | 361 desktop_file_list = gtk_list_store_new(DESKTOP_FILE_COLUMN_COUNT, G_TYPE_STRING, G_TYPE_STRING, G_TYPE_STRING, G_TYPE_BOOLEAN, G_TYPE_STRING); |
362 } | 362 } |
363 if (editors) | 363 if (editors) |
364 { | 364 { |
365 g_hash_table_destroy(editors); | 365 g_hash_table_destroy(editors); |
366 } | 366 } |